
Tampa Men's Lacrosse Ranked Fifth in USILA Poll
LOUISVILLE, Ky. – The University of Tampa men's lacrosse team has been ranked fifth in the United States Intercollegiate Lacrosse Association (USILA) poll. This is the highest preseason ranking the Spartans have earned since the 2017 season when they were ranked fourth to begin the season.
The Spartans finished last season with a final record of 15-6, as they fell to eventual National Runnerup Limestone in the NCAA Quarterfinals. In the 2019 season, UT claimed its sixth consecutive Sunshine State Conference tournament championship. The Spartans return two players who were named to the All-Tournament team as Ross Dickerson and Bryan Wright will look to lead UT to another title. Dickerson earned Most Outstanding Player for the second consecutive year.
Two other Sunshine State Conference foes are represented in the top-20, as Lynn University is ranked 16th and Rollins College is ranked 17th. Florida Southern College and Florida Tech are receiving votes in the poll. UT will face five teams ranked in the preseason ranking, with the first of those matchups coming on March 4th, as they will face off against third-ranked Adelphi University.
Tampa will begin the 2020 season next Saturday as they will welcome in Queens College of Charlotte into the Naimoli Family Athletic and Intramural Complex.
